Valencia CF support International Deaf Day

As part of International Deaf Day, Valencia CF coach Albert Celades' pre-match press conference for the game against Athletic Club was translated into sign language at the Ciudad Deportiva Media Centre.
The club have been collaborating with the Valencian Federation For The Deaf (FESORD C.V.) to give visibility to the activities the regional group have organised throughout this week, starting on Monday (International Sign Language Day) and ending on Saturday (International Deaf Day).
Some of the VCF Academy players from the Cadete A, Cadete Fundación and Infantil A teams received an informative talk at the Ciudad Deportiva from Karin Bos, the FESORD C.V. sign language specialist. She explained what the daily life of a deaf person entails, as well as how adaptation is being made through new technology and social media. The players ended the meeting by learning football-related sign language words.
